Lethbridge Herald April 21, 1999
BONDY JULIADEAN RIRIE SMITH BONDY passed away peacefully In the Raymond Hospital on Saturday, April 17,1999 at the age of 85 years. She was born on February 26, 1914 in the red brick farmhouse at Magrath, AB.

Juliadean was the daughter of James B. Ririe and Julia Emily Hawkes. She was the youngest of 18 children, and the last to pass away.

She loved her brothers and sisters, and their families. She was very proud of their accomplishments, and proud of her noble heritage. She has lived in Magrath most of her life, but spent time in Utah, California and Arizona, with her first husband, Leonard Smith and, their 4 children

.After her divorce, she moved back to Magrath, where she married Leonard Bondy, and they had 2 children.

Juliadean was an avid learner, and received her teaching degree in Calgary, in 1955. She taught school in 'Magrath, and at the Hutterite colonies. She loved those she taught, and made a great impression in the lives of her students. She was active in the LDS church, and held many teaching positions. In her later years, she was involved in the French Extraction program, and loved the work she was doing, until she was unable to do it anymore.

Juliadean had a great work ethic, ant taught her children well, the value of work, and if it was worth doing, it was worth doing well. She has left to mourn her passing, 6 children, her good friend, Leonard Bondy, 46 grandchildren, 52 great grandchildren, and 1 great, great grandchild, with 2 more expected this year.
